5th Grade Clap Out
The 5th Grade Clap out will start around 3:00 on May 26th. This is where the rest of the student body lines the hallways of the school and cheer on our 5th graders as they leave Marshall for the last time. We invite 5th grade families to come in and join the end of the line. Please park in the upper parking lot. You may want to plan to arrive by 2:50 to be on time.
